The Importance of the Rebuild Kit for Maintenance and Upgrades
When it comes to the maintenance and enhancement of machinery, vehicles, and various equipment, the concept of a rebuild kit plays a crucial role. These kits, designed specifically for the restoration or enhancement of components, are invaluable for both DIY enthusiasts and professional mechanics alike. The rebuild kit for any given system serves not only as a convenient means of repair but also as a significant factor influencing the performance and longevity of the equipment.

One of the primary advantages of using a rebuild kit is the cost-effectiveness it offers. Purchasing individual components can become a costly endeavor, particularly when trying to source rare or specific parts. A rebuild kit consolidates these items into one affordable package, making it an economically sensible choice. For instance, individuals looking to overhaul an engine frequently opt for an engine rebuild kit rather than sourcing each component separately. This not only saves money but also time and effort spent searching for various parts.
In addition to cost savings, rebuild kits also contribute to enhanced performance. When components wear down over time, they can significantly affect the efficiency and functionality of the entire system. By replacing these worn-out parts with new ones from a rebuild kit, users can restore their equipment to its original state or even improve its performance. This is particularly true in high-performance applications, where minor enhancements can lead to significant gains in speed, power, and efficiency.
Furthermore, rebuild kits often include upgrades that can enhance the durability or efficiency of a system. Manufacturers recognize the importance of innovation and often incorporate improved materials or designs in their rebuild kits, offering customers the benefit of advanced technology in their repairs. For example, an automotive rebuild kit may include high-performance oil seals or upgraded gaskets designed to withstand higher temperatures and pressures, ultimately extending the life of the engine.
Another noteworthy aspect of rebuild kits is their role in sustainability. The act of rebuilding and servicing equipment rather than replacing it entirely aligns with environmentally conscious practices. By utilizing a rebuild kit, users can extend the life of their machinery and reduce waste, supporting a more sustainable approach to maintenance. This is especially relevant in a world that increasingly values eco-friendly practices and seeks to minimize the impact of consumerism on the environment.
